Understanding DTF Technology The Technical Breakdown

DTF printing is an innovative digital printing process that employs producing designs on unique PET film using water-based inks and hot-melt powder. In contrast to standard printing processes, DTF transfers can be applied to cotton, polyester, nylon, leather, and blended fabrics without pretreatment. This versatility makes DTF printer technology increasingly popular among companies looking for effective, premium printing solutions.

The technique creates prints that are simultaneously visually stunning but also incredibly durable. DTF transfers endure cracking, peeling, and fading even after multiple washes, making them perfect for business use where durability is essential. With the capability to create detailed artwork, gradients, and lifelike pictures, DTF printing provides limitless creative options for your company.

How to Create DTF Transfers: Complete Tutorial

Making high-end DTF transfers requires understanding each phase of the workflow. Here's a thorough breakdown:

1. Artwork Development

First designing your graphic using creative applications like professional design tools, or simpler options like online design platforms. Export your design as a high-quality PNG file with a transparent background. The beauty of DTF printing is that you can work with intricate full-color artwork without worrying about color restrictions.

2. The Printing Process

Import your design into the DTF printer software. The printer will initially lay down the CMYK inks (CMYK) directly onto the PET film, followed by a white ink layer that acts as a base. This white layer is vital for achieving vivid tones on dark fabrics. Contemporary DTF printer models can attain speeds of up to 40 linear meters per minute, making them perfect for mass production.

3. Applying Adhesive Powder

While the ink is still wet, evenly apply hot-melt adhesive powder across the entire printed design. This powder is what bonds the DTF transfer to the fabric during application. Use a see-saw motion to achieve complete coverage, then eliminate any excess powder. Many companies are now purchasing automated powder shakers for consistent results.

4. Heat Setting

The adhesive powder requires melted and cured before application. This can be accomplished using a specialized oven (recommended for optimal results) or by hovering under a heat press. Curing usually takes 60-90 seconds in an oven at the proper temperature. Proper curing ensures your DTF transfers can be stored for later use or used immediately.

5. Heat Press Application

First press your garment for 10 seconds to eliminate humidity and creases. Place your DTF transfer on the fabric and press at appropriate temperature for 15-20 seconds with moderate force. The heat activates the adhesive, establishing a lasting connection between the design and fabric.

6. Removal and Finishing

Once pressed, remove the film while it's still hot in one fluid movement. This warm removal method provides clean edges and prevents unwanted lines in your design. To finish, complete a second press for another short duration to improve durability and decrease shine.

The Rise of DTF Technology the Market in 2025

The DTF printing market has seen remarkable expansion, valued at $2.72 billion in 2024 and forecast to reach almost $4 billion by 2030. This remarkable development is fueled by several important elements:

Exceptional Adaptability

In contrast with other printing methods, DTF transfers function with almost every fabric textile without preprocessing. From natural fibers to artificial fabrics, diverse textiles, DTF printing delivers uniform, professional results across all surfaces.

Any Volume Production

Whether you need one custom shirt or bulk orders, DTF printer technology removes setup costs and minimum quantities. This versatility makes it excellent for just-in-time production, individual designs, and testing new designs without monetary commitment.

Premium Results

Contemporary DTF printing generates remarkably precise, vibrant prints that equal or beat conventional techniques. The technology performs best with creating photo-realistic designs, intricate blends, and fine details that would be challenging with alternative techniques.

Budget-Friendly Operations

With reduced initial investment than screen printing and quicker turnaround than DTG printing, DTF transfers provide an excellent return on investment. The ability to group different artwork on a single sheet additionally minimizes costs and resource consumption.

Essential Equipment for Successful Operations

To begin your DTF printing business, you'll want the following machinery:

  • DTF Printer: Select among dedicated machines by manufacturers like top manufacturers, or convert existing printers for DTF printing
  • DTF Inks: Formulated textile inks designed for best adhesion and color vibrancy
  • PET Film: Available in different sizes, with hot-peel or cold-peel options
  • Transfer Powder: Standard powder for most applications, dark for dark designs on dark fabrics
  • Heat Press: Industrial press with consistent temperature and pressure
  • Curing Oven: For proper powder curing (essential)
  • Print Software: For print optimization and print optimization
